Respondents Prayer : Writ Petition is fil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, praying this Court to issue a Writ of Mandamus, directing the Respondent no.1 to re-issue / renew the petitioner's passport bearing No. M5001495 by processing his application in File No. MD2076511448226 in accordance with law within the time stipulated by this Court. 1/6 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P.(MD)No.14477 of 2026 For Petitioner : Dr.R.Alagumani For Respondents : Mr.R.Paranjothi Central Government Standing Counsel for R1 : Mr.R.Mohamed Riyaz, Government Advocate(Crl. Side) for R2 O R D E R The petitioner is before this Court seeking issuance of a Writ of Mandamus directing the first respondent to re-issue a passport bearing No.M5001495 to the petitioner based on the petitioner’s application in File No. MD2076511448226. 2. The petitioner’s request for issuance of a passport has not been processed on the ground that a criminal case is pending against the petitioner before the Judicial Magistrate No.2, Nagercoil, in C.C. No. 774 of 2023. 2/6 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P.(MD)No.14477 of 2026 3. The Hon’ble Full Bench of this Court in W.P.(MD) No. 26547 of 2025, while answering a reference as to whether the re-issue/renewal of a passport should be treated in the same manner as the issuance of a fresh passport or merely as a case of renewal, held that the re-issue/renewal of a passport must be treated in the same manner as the issuance of a fresh passport. However, liberty was granted to the petitioner therein to obtain prior permission from the concerned Court and submit the same along with the passport application, as contemplated under the Passport Act, 1967. 4. In view of the above, this Writ Petition is disposed of granting liberty to the petitioner to approach the jurisdictional Court, where the criminal case is pending, and file an appropriate application seeking permission for issuance/renewal of the passport. If such an application is filed, the criminal Court concerned shall consider and pass appropriate orders within a period of four weeks from the date of filing of the application. 3/6 https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is W.P.(MD)No.14477 of 2026 5.
